一、引言
在信息化高速发展的今天,系统稳定性已成为企业运营的核心要素之一。运维工程师,作为这一领域的守护者,承担着确保系统稳定运行的重任。他们通过专业技能和不懈努力,为企业的业务连续性提供了坚实的保障。本文将深入探讨运维工程师在系统维护中的核心角色与职责,以及他们如何通过专业技能确保系统的稳定运行。
二、运维工程师的角色与职责
运维工程师是IT团队中不可或缺的一员,他们负责维护和管理工作中的IT基础设施,确保系统的正常运行。具体来说,运维工程师的职责包括以下几个方面:
- 系统监控
运维工程师需要实时监控系统的运行状态,包括服务器、网络设备、存储设备等,及时发现并处理潜在的问题。他们利用专业的监控工具,对系统的各项性能指标进行持续跟踪和分析,确保系统始终处于最佳运行状态。通过实时监控,运维工程师能够迅速发现系统的异常行为,从而及时采取措施,避免潜在的系统故障对企业运营造成不良影响。
- 故障处理
当系统出现故障时,运维工程师需要迅速定位问题并采取有效的措施进行修复。他们凭借丰富的经验和专业技能,能够迅速找到问题的根源,并采取相应的解决方案,确保系统的稳定性和可用性。故障处理是运维工程师工作中最为重要的一环,他们需要在最短的时间内恢复系统的正常运行,以减少故障对企业运营的影响。
- 系统优化
为了提高系统的运行效率和响应速度,运维工程师需要对系统进行性能优化。他们通过对系统的架构、配置、代码等方面进行深入分析,找出潜在的性能瓶颈,并进行相应的优化调整,确保系统能够高效、稳定地运行。系统优化不仅能够提高企业的运营效率,还能够降低企业的运营成本,为企业创造更大的价值。
- 安全管理
保障系统的安全性是运维工程师的重要职责之一。他们需要制定并执行严格的安全策略,包括数据备份、病毒防护、入侵检测等,确保系统的数据安全不受威胁。随着网络攻击的不断增多,运维工程师需要时刻保持警惕,加强系统的安全防护措施,确保企业的信息安全。
三、运维工程师的核心技能
作为一名优秀的运维工程师,需要具备以下核心技能:
- 技术能力
熟悉常见的操作系统、网络设备、存储设备等,掌握Linux/Unix命令行操作、网络协议、数据库管理等技能。这些技能是运维工程师进行日常维护和故障处理的基础。只有具备了扎实的技术能力,运维工程师才能够更好地应对各种复杂的系统问题。
- 工具使用能力
熟悉并能够熟练使用各种运维工具,如监控工具、性能测试工具、自动化部署工具等。这些工具能够帮助运维工程师更加高效地完成工作,提高系统的稳定性和可用性。通过合理使用运维工具,运维工程师能够实现对系统的全面监控和管理,确保系统的正常运行。
- 问题解决能力
具备快速定位问题并解决问题的能力,能够根据问题的现象快速分析原因并采取有效的措施。这是运维工程师在工作中不可或缺的一项技能。只有具备了强大的问题解决能力,运维工程师才能够在最短的时间内恢复系统的正常运行,减少故障对企业运营的影响。
- 学习能力
随着技术的发展和更新,运维工程师需要不断学习新的知识和技能,以适应不断变化的IT环境。他们需要保持对新技术的敏锐感知,并能够及时将其应用到实际工作中。通过不断学习,运维工程师能够不断提升自己的专业技能和综合素质,为企业的发展做出更大的贡献。
四、运维工程师的工作环境与挑战
运维工程师的工作环境通常是一个复杂的IT系统,他们需要与开发人员、测试人员、业务人员等多个团队进行协作。在工作中,他们面临着诸多挑战,如系统故障的快速响应、复杂问题的解决、系统性能的优化等。同时,随着云计算、大数据、人工智能等新技术的不断发展,运维工程师需要不断学习和掌握新的知识和技能,以应对新的挑战和机遇。只有不断适应新技术的发展,运维工程师才能够更好地为企业的发展提供有力支持。
五、运维工程师的未来发展
随着信息技术的不断发展和普及,运维工程师的岗位需求将会越来越大。未来,运维工程师将需要掌握更多的新技术和新技能,以适应不断变化的市场需求。同时,随着企业对系统稳定性和安全性的要求越来越高,运维工程师的工作也将变得更加重要和复杂。因此,运维工程师需要不断提升自己的专业技能和综合素质,以适应未来的职业发展需求。